Driver Software for Data Acquisition
and Signal Conditioning
185
National Instruments • T
el: (800) 433-3488
•
Fax: (512) 683-9300
•
[email protected] •
ni.com
Driver Software
DAQ and Signal Conditioning
Overview
The quality of your configuration and driver software is just as
important as the quality of your measurement hardware. NI-DAQ
is a robust, time-proven driver for NI data acquisition and signal
conditioning hardware. This software helps you quickly install your
device and begin taking measurement data. NI-DAQ includes
hundreds of application examples to jump-start your application
development. NI-DAQ delivers the same ease of use and
performance across many development environments, operating
systems, and computer buses.
Integrated Software Framework
Software ties the various pieces of measurement hardware
together into a complete measurement system. National
Instruments provides an integrated software framework (see
Figure 1) to increase development productivity and decrease cost.
NI-DAQ is part of the measurement and control services software,
which tightly integrates NI measurement hardware with your
application development environment. Because NI-DAQ is built in
this framework, you can easily integrate and synchronize multiple
measurement types, including motion and vision, with your data
acquisition system. With this flexible, hardware-independent
software, you can achieve interactive configuration, powerful
programming, and excellent measurement performance.
Configuration with Measurement & Automation Explorer
Measurement & Automation Explorer simplifies the configuration
of your measurement hardware, so you can:
• Quickly detect and configure all hardware
• Use test panels to verify the operation of your hardware
(See Figure 4)
• Make simple, interactive measurements
• Name and scale your I/O channels to physical or engineering
units (See Figure 3)
Powerful Programming
NI-DAQ software isolates you from hardware-specific register
commands and gives you a simple, yet powerful application
programming interface (API) between the complete hardware
capabilities and a wide variety of development environments and
languages. Because of the consistent API, you can use different
DAQ hardware with the same application without modifying
your software.
High-Performance Measurements
NI-DAQ is optimized for measurement performance and ease of
use. NI-DAQ software delivers:
•Efficiency and speed through event-driven programming
• Synchronization of measurements across multiple devices
• Seamless integration of measurement accessories
• Flawless buffer and DMA management
•Driver software for NI data
acquisition and signal conditioning
hardware
• Short time to first measurement
with quick configuration and
application-specific example
programs
• Named and scaled channels
remove configuration complexity
• Multiple-device synchronization
and integration with RTSI or PXI
trigger bus
• Networking features for remote
and distributed measurements
• Robust double-buffered DMA
data management routines
Operating Systems
•Windows 2000/NT/XP/Me/9x
• Mac OS 9
• Others such as Linux (see page 187)
• Real-Time performance with
LabVIEW (page 134)
Recommended Software
• LabVIEW
• LabWindows/CVI
• Measurement Studio
for Visual Basic
• VI Logger
Other Compatible Software
•Visual Basic
• C/C++
NI-DAQ
Kommentare zu diesen Handbüchern